The Falicov-Kimball model describes two species: heavy (f) electrons that are localized and form a classical binary field w_i ∈ {0,1}, and light (c) electrons that hop with amplitude t. The f-electrons' static configuration is determined by minimizing the free energy. At half-filling (n_f=0.5) and large U, a checkerboard charge-density wave forms below a critical temperature.
